At least eight killed in crush at Africa Cup of Nations at Cameroon stadium

At least eight people have been killed and dozens more were injured in a crush outside an Africa Cup of Nations football match in Cameroon.

Videos showed how crowds of screaming football fans were crushed at the entry gates of the stadium as thousands of fans tried to get inside.

Of the 38 injured people, seven are in a serious condition and one child is among those who died said officials.

Due to the Covid restrictions, the stadium was not supposed to be more than 80% full for the game – even if the stadium has a capacity for 60 000.

According to match officials, about 50 000 people were trying to attend.

According to journalists at the stadium fans were trying to force themselves into the stadium even as they were being kept back.

The Confederation of African Football (CAF) said in a statement that it was investigating the situation.

The last 16 match between Cameroon and Comoros took place despite the incident and ended with a 2-1 win for the hosts.
